Hood mod and hood pins completed today. As others have done I used the Traxxas battery strap pegs and will epoxy metal washers to the hood and cable the actual pins to the front horizontal tube for more realism. I will throw up some images later tonight. I have been giving some thought to the shocks. I want more scale realism but do not wish to totally sacrifice performance. I think I will go with GMade XD 103mm shocks with piggyback resivoirs and adjustment screws to change dampening. I cannot stand the blue of the King shocks and the Protrac shocks seem to large scale wise in diameter. Well I received an e-mail back from Hobbico, the distributor for Tactic servos. In my e-mail to them I asked how well their high end servo, TowerHobbies.com | Tactic TSX65 Standard Digital Ultra-Torque HV MG Servo compares to the high end Hitec servos. Here is Hobbico's response; "We do not have figures here concerning durability and longevity, but considering that the Hitec servos you mention are twice as expensive as the Tactic servos mentioned, and using the principle "you get what you pay for," I would expect the Hitec servos to be superior in those characteristics." Good thing is that they seems to be honest. Bad thing, I already ordered two of their servos for the steering on my Wraith. Well it is August 13th and things are coming right along, slowly perhaps with this back injury I have been dealing with since I was rear ended in May, but coming along none-the-less. As of today; -Interior is ready for paint then installation of detail parts and lighting -Waiting on the Flying Dutchman electronics trays which will arrive tomorrow for electronics installation -Shocks built and installed, not sure I think too much about the GMADE XD's. The composite caps took me back a little. One resevoir is leaking and the soft springs are not available at RPP. In addition, they are way too big for scale appearances -I received the RC4WD Militant beadlock rims which I ordered for a temporary setup until Vanquish gets all of the modular SLW parts in the colors I want in stock. Read my post in the Tire and Wheel section on them. -I have started to setup my Futaba 4PLS and the truck radio electronics... I am having some glitching issues with the digitial servos from Tactic. I need to re-wire the BEC's to see if that is what is causing it before I Hulk Rage at anything. lol -The fast-back mod is completed. I just need to do a little sanding and some paint when I do the other paint. -Hood mod is done except for epoxying the washers to the hood for a more scale appearance. -Programmed all the BEC's and the MMP on Saturday night... running two for steering using alternate wiring method, one for Gear Head lighting, and one for the 3Racing winch. -Lights will be hooked up to micro switches in the interior console while the winch will be on channel 4.
